The Lanthorn suggestion service stopped refreshing its prefix index on Friday; the refresh worker's token to the Mosswick index API expired and the job silently retried, leaving the index stale and forcing fallback full-text scans, hence the slow completions. The fix in the attached branch adds expiry alerting and swaps the worker to a long-lived service credential. Reviewers should verify the retry loop now fails loudly. For local verification against staging Mosswick, use the key below.

gateway credential: kto3_qfe

Handing off the Quillbus broker upgrade (4.x to 5.1) to Dario. Cluster is half-migrated; mixed-version mode is supported but TLS cert rotation must finish before cutover. No auth model changes, though the admin API gained two new endpoints worth reviewing. Open questions and the migration checklist are tracked on the internal page below.

dashboard of taduf-bawef = https://jira.lumicsys.internal/projects/display/browse/b1cbf89d

Hi all — welcome to the Lanternfish release channel. Today's deploy changes pagination on the public REST API: cursor-based paging replaces page numbers, and the old offset parameters are now ignored with a deprecation warning. New folks, please read the pagination guide before answering partner questions. Rollout is gradual over two days. The canary build is identified by the token below.

build token for tawip-yageg: htk9_92ac43d42